About Loreen:
After nearly three decades in the corporate world, Loreen realised that success on paper does not always bring clarity, alignment, or fulfilment.
Her own season of healing and transition led her into a deeper journey of self-discovery through coaching, NLP, Enneagram, and Bazi—a personal growth path that has since become the heart of her work.
Today, as the founder of Tsuyu Mori Studio and a certified life coach, Loreen supports people navigating growth, transition, or a season they may have outgrown.
In her work, she adopts Bazi not to predict destiny, but to draw from its philosophy of elemental energies—understanding how they may shape one’s natural tendencies, life choices, and the season one is in.
